I definitely love the dollar tree! I've bought tons of fake plants, diy hides, those little dome terrerium things, pots, glass and ceramic bowls to use as digging areas, food and water dishes, I've used the little bar soap holders that have suction cups as little ledges for my arboreal geckos, and have made hammocks out if the little hooks and bandanas. My leopard gecko can't be kept on loose soil because of some birth defects, so I also buy the non adhesive cabinet liners a lot and often buy containers to keep and breed feeder insects in. There are definitely a ton of neat finds! I also like going to thrift stores which often have fake plants, different glass and ceramic dishes, baskets you could make into hides, and even reptile specific products including tanks. You just have to remember to always sanitize everything!
